Suara.com – The Mining Police Criminal Investigation Unit arrested two men with the initials AL (46) and AA (26) suspected of misusing subsidized diesel fuel (BBM) on Jalan Raya Bangkinang-Pekanbaru KM 28, Kualu Nenas Village, Tambang District, Kampar Regency, Riau.
“The two were caught red-handed transferring diesel fuel from a truck to a 35 liter jerry can. We have arrested the perpetrators at the Police Headquarters,” said Kampar Police Chief AKBP Didik Priyo Sambodo SIK through Mining Police Chief Iptu Mardani Tohenes to the media in Kampar, Saturday (28/1/2023 ).
Mardani said that this case was revealed after his party received a report from the public and then officers conducted an investigation.
He stated that based on the results of the investigation, he stated that a BM-8129-FQ truck belonging to the perpetrator was stopping at a house. Based on community information, the house belongs to a man with the initials AL.

Officers who visited the location found the suspect AA transferring oil from a truck’s tank to a large jerry can.
“The suspect AA was caught red-handed transferring oil from trucks to jerry cans,” said Mardani.
The Criminal Investigation Team immediately moved into the house and found 16 jerry cans containing more than 544 liters of subsidized diesel oil and five empty jerry cans. In addition to the truck and fuel evidence, the Criminal Investigation team also secured a 3/4 centimeter, one meter long hose.
The actions of the two perpetrators, said Mardani, violated Article 55 and Article 40 of the Republic of Indonesia Law number 11 of 2020 concerning Job Creation regarding changes to the Republic of Indonesia Law Number 22 of 2001 concerning Oil and Gas. (Between)
